serine/threonine protein kinase Nek6; never in mitosis A-related kinase 6; NimA-related protein kinase 6; protein kinase SID6-1512 (NEK6)

Function: - protein kinase plays an important role in mitotic cell cycle progression - required for chromosome segregation at metaphase-anaphase transition, robust mitotic spindle formation & cytokinesis - phosphorylates ATF4, CIR1, PTN, RAD26L, RBBP6, RPS7, RPS6KB1, TRIP4, STAT3 & histones H1 & H3 - phosphorylates KIF11 to promote mitotic spindle formation - role in G2/M phase cell cycle arrest induced by DNA damage - inhibition of activity results in apoptosis - may contribute to tumorigenesis by suppressing p53/TP53- induced cancer cell senescence - binding to NEK9 stimulates its activity by releasing the autoinhibitory function of Tyr-108 - autophosphorylated - phosphorylation at Ser-206 is required for its activation - phosphorylated upon IR or UV-induced DNA damage - phosphorylated by CHK1 & CHK2 - interaction with APBB1 - down-regulates phosphorylation at Thr-210 - interacts with STAT3 & RPS6KB1 (putative) - interacts with NEK9, predominantly in mitosis - interacts with KIF11 (via C-terminus) - interacts with APBB1 (via WW domain) - interacts with ANKRA2, ATF4, ARHGAP33, CDC42, CIR1, PRAM1, PTN, PRDX3, PIN1, RAD26L, RBBP6, RPS7 & TRIP4 Cofactor: Mg+2 Structure: - displays an autoinhibited conformation: Tyr-108 side chain points into the active site, interacts with the activation loop, & blocks the alphaC helix - the autoinhibitory conformation is released upon binding with NEK9 - belongs to the protein kinase superfamily, NEK Ser/Thr protein kinase family, NIMA subfamily - contains 1 protein kinase domain Compartment: - cytoplasm, nucleus, nuclear speckle - cytoskeleton, centrosome, spindle pole - colocalizes with APBB1 at the nuclear speckles - colocalizes with PIN1 in the nucleus - colocalizes with ATF4, CIR1, ARHGAP33, ANKRA2, CDC42, NEK9, RAD26L, RBBP6, RPS7, TRIP4, RELB & PHF1 in the centrosome - localizes to spindle microtubules in metaphase & anaphase & to the midbody during cytokinesis Alternative splicing: named isoforms=4 Expression: - ubiquitous - highest expression in heart & skeletal muscle - up-regulated during the M phase of cell cycle progression - down-regulated in both replicative senescence & premature senescence of cancer cells Pathology: - up-regulated in a variety of malignant cancers, such as breast cancer, colorectal carcinoma, lung carcinoma, & gastric cancers
